
Hi all after I left the dash at Ouarzazate I headed to Tinehir and the Gorges de todra I made my way via Assoul to Rich and then Stayed in a small hotel at the start of the Gorges du Ziz then down to Er Rachida the following morning then turned round and headed back up country picked up a 3inch nail in the rear tyre got it repaired in a small village after having aggro with the bm kit. how I laughed as I saw Morrocan Vulacanizing in action for the first time the equipment appeared to be an old fly press with a tefal domestic iron welded on to it with the tyre off they cut small patches of rubber placed them on the inside over the hole then when the iron was hot enough wound the press down and left it there till the patch melted I had real doubts about the repair but in all fairness it lasted all the way home so it cant be that bad. Later as I was just past Irfrane I saw what I assume where baboons in a wooded area. on friday I crossed back into Spain and experinced shocking weather near Granada in the form of sleet and a thunderstorm I finally got home to Poole at midnight last night fecked but contented that I had acheaved a long held dream to visit the african continenent on my GS I would like to thank Neil and everyone else on the dash for making this possible hope you all made it home safe and look forward to seeing you all at the Hograost.
